Telehealth Visits – Quick Docs From Your Couch
Video appointments let you talk to a licensed physician in minutes. Most platforms require a brief health questionnaire before matching you with a doctor. Once connected, the clinician can prescribe meds, order labs, or give lifestyle advice just like an office visit.
To stay safe, pick services that show their medical staff’s credentials and have clear privacy policies. Check for reviews on independent sites; a pattern of quick approvals without questions often means a red flag.
Reputable Online Pharmacies – Where to Fill Prescriptions
If you already have a prescription, ordering from a vetted pharmacy can be smoother than calling your local store. Look for pharmacies that display a valid license number, require a doctor’s note, and offer real‑time customer support.
Price comparison tools are handy, but never sacrifice safety for the lowest price. Trusted sites usually list shipping times, return policies, and a secure payment gateway. Avoid any site that promises “no prescription needed” for controlled substances.

How to Verify Safety in Seconds
1. Check the domain – .org, .gov, and well‑known .com sites are usually safer.
2. Look for a physical address and contact number; scammers hide these details.
3. Confirm the pharmacy’s license through your country's health regulator website.
4. Read recent customer feedback; ignore sites with only glowing testimonials.
Following these steps can cut down the risk of counterfeit pills, privacy breaches, or wasted money.
